1. Clean and Dust Regularly:
Dust and dirt can quickly build up on gym equipment, causing it to malfunction or wear out faster. Regularly dusting and cleaning your equipment with a damp cloth can help prevent this buildup and keep your machines running smoothly. Pay special attention to areas where dirt tends to accumulate, such as around the belts and pulleys of treadmills and elliptical machines.

2. Lubricate Moving Parts:
Many home gym machines have moving parts that require regular lubrication to operate smoothly. Check your equipment’s user manual for specific instructions on which parts need lubrication and how often. Using the recommended lubricant can prevent excessive friction, reduce wear and tear, and extend the life of your machines.

3. Check for Wear and Tear:
Regularly inspect your gym equipment for any signs of wear and tear, such as frayed cables, loose bolts, or cracked surfaces.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and ensure the safety of your workouts. If you notice any significant damage, contact a professional for repairs or replacement parts.

4. Keep Your Gym Equipment in a Cool and Dry Environment:
Mobile, AL, is known for its hot and humid climate, which can affect the performance of your gym equipment. To prevent rust, corrosion, and damage from moisture, it is essential to keep your gym equipment in a cool and dry environment. Consider investing in a dehumidifier or placing silica gel packs near your equipment to absorb excess moisture.

5. Follow Manufacturer’s Guidelines:
Each piece of gym equipment comes with specific maintenance guidelines provided by the manufacturer. It is crucial to follow these guidelines to ensure proper care and maintenance of your machines. Ignoring these instructions can void warranties and lead to costly repairs down the line.
